Is Lyons Avenue Park Safe?

No — this is a high-crime area. Lyons Avenue Park in Houston, TX has a safety grade of D. The overall crime index is 185, which is 85% above the national average of 100.

Compared to the Houston average (crime index 109), Lyons Avenue Park is 76% higher in overall crime. Residents and visitors should exercise extra caution in this area, particularly after dark.

Looking at specific crime types, assault is the most elevated concern (index: 180, 80% above average), while robbery is the lowest risk (index: 57).
